Right, nearly there now. Scenery mostly in place just need something in the far corner to hide the plaster finish and then spray it with the sealer.

Seems to have been someting of an explosion in the bottom r/h corner.

R-

EDIT: Just looked at the YT video again and it seems I misunderstood. It is not a scenic sealer but a scenic cement. Not sure I need that on this scenery as it is mainly scatter.

That looks good Roger - I sprayed my hill with WS Scenic Cement - it does spray very well. The WS spray bottle is also very good - £5 from Hattons, but a lot more from everywhere else. Barry
